(1) HOW I FOUND HEALTH IN THE DENTIST'S CHAIR (2) HOW TO STORE YOUR CAR IN WINTER (3) HOW A FARMER'S WIFE MADE $55 EXTRA (4) HOW TO SUCCEED AS A WRITER Woman Who "Knew She Could Write" Tells How She Began and Finally Got on the Right Road The "how" title may also be used for an article that explains some phenomenon or process. Examples of such titles are these: (1) HOW A NETTLE STINGS (2) HOW RIPE OLIVES ARE MADE (3) HOW THE FREIGHT CAR GETS HOME Articles that undertake to give causes and reasons are appropriately given "why" titles like the following: |
